Crafting Perfection: The Best Cocktails at 12 Rocks

No visit to 12 Rocks is complete without sampling their world-class cocktails, which have garnered acclaim across Australian beach club reviews. The bar's mixologists, trained in both classic techniques and innovative twists, use fresh Australian fruits, native botanicals, and premium spirits to create drinks that are as visually stunning as they are delicious. With a focus on balance—sweet, sour, and salty notes inspired by the sea—each cocktail tells a story of the coast.

Signature Cocktails That Steal the Show

Start with the "Rock Hopper," a refreshing blend of gin, muddled bush lemons, and a splash of ocean-inspired saline. This drink, priced around AUD 18, captures the zesty essence of the Australian outback meeting the sea. Reviewers rave about its crisp finish, perfect for cooling off after a swim.

For something more indulgent, the "Sunset Lagoon" features rum infused with pineapple and coconut, topped with a flaming torch for dramatic flair. At AUD 20, it's a favorite for evening gatherings, often paired with the bar's glowing lantern-lit terrace. One visitor noted in a popular review site:

"The Sunset Lagoon isn't just a drink; it's a mini-vacation in a glass. The flames add that wow factor, and the flavors transport you straight to a tropical paradise."

Tequila lovers shouldn't miss the "Coastal Margarita," a twist on the classic with native warrigal greens for a subtle herbal kick and fresh lime from local groves. This AUD 19 concoction has been highlighted in recent coast beach bar news for its low-sugar profile, appealing to health-focused patrons.

The bar also offers a rotating seasonal menu, incorporating ingredients like quandong (a native Australian peach) in gin fizzes or finger lime in martinis. These innovations keep the cocktail list dynamic, ensuring repeat visits. Non-alcoholic options, such as the "Mocktail Mirage" with sparkling elderflower and cucumber, maintain the same high standards, making 12 Rocks inclusive for all.

Seafood Sensations: Fresh from the Ocean to Your Plate

Seafood is the beating heart of 12 Rocks' menu, and it's no wonder the bar tops lists for the best seafood in Australian beach clubs. Sourced daily from sustainable local waters, the offerings highlight Australia's diverse marine life, from prawns to snapper. The kitchen, led by a chef with coastal roots, prioritizes grilling and steaming to preserve natural flavors, often served with sides of native greens and zesty sauces.

Must-Try Dishes and Flavor Profiles

Begin with the Seafood Platter for Two (AUD 85), a bounty including king prawns, oysters on the half-shell, calamari rings, and smoked barramundi. Freshness is key here—each element arrives chilled on ice, with lemon wedges and a house-made aioli that reviewers call "addictively tangy."

For mains, the Grilled Whole Snapper (AUD 42) is a standout, seasoned simply with sea salt, herbs, and a drizzle of native macadamia oil. Served with roasted chat potatoes and a side salad, it's praised for its flaky texture and subtle smokiness. In beach club reviews, this dish frequently earns five-star ratings for its authenticity:

"Eating the grilled snapper at 12 Rocks felt like dining in nature's own restaurant. The fish was so fresh, it melted in your mouth—truly the best seafood I've had in Australia."

Lighter options include the Prawn Tacos (AUD 24), stuffed with grilled prawns, slaw made from red cabbage and lime, and a chili-infused mayo. These handheld delights are perfect for sharing during happy hour, which runs from 4-6 PM daily and features half-price select seafood bites.

Vegetarian and gluten-free adaptations are readily available, such as the Seared Scallops with quinoa (AUD 28), ensuring everyone can partake in the coastal feast.
